S. , preventing states from legislating in sure areas of federal immigration law, by authorizing both state and native governments to enforce federal law and to create their very own immigration enforcement legal guidelines. States and localities that decline to enforce federal immigration law would lose federal funds. Prison prosecution for illegal presence: Makes unlawful presence within the United States a criminal act for the first time and imposes jail time for the offense. Traditionally unlawful presence alone has been a civil violation, not against the law.

Introduced by Rep. Grimm (R-NY) on February 14, 2013. 14 Republican and Democratic co-sponsors as of April 2014. Gives extra inexperienced cards for immigrants with superior levels in STEM fields and certain immigrant entrepreneurs.
